Huttig, AR vs Wooster, AR
There is a significant gap in the cost of living between these two cities. Huttig is 15.6% cheaper than Wooster. With a cost index of 75 vs 89, the difference would have a meaningful impact on a household's monthly budget. Someone relocating from Huttig to Wooster should plan for substantially higher expenses across most categories.
When it comes to buying, median home values in Huttig are $47,000 compared to $292,900 in Wooster, a 84% gap.
Median household income in Huttig is $36,989 compared to $107,813 in Wooster (-65.7%). While Wooster is more expensive, its higher salaries more than compensate — residents there may actually end up with more disposable income.
